Output 75a36d76851c45f41abe960c6bea410f0869615e18716cf039ae8adf77e2487e:7

value
1400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c468a38567488ee45b65ab1214c231e8d178d7d8 OP_EQUALVERIFY OP_CHECKSIG
address
1JuWo2ZQ32UvvB1PcgWFWBpPGWiKahEkCz
transaction
75a36d76851c45f41abe960c6bea410f0869615e18716cf039ae8adf77e2487e
spent
true